Predictive Maintenance and Technician Intelligence
Plant-floor teams lose hours searching through fragmented maintenance logs, OEM manuals, and tribal knowledge stored only in senior technicians' heads. A private LLM deployed on-prem or at the edge indexes vibration records, thermal history, work orders, and fault codes so any technician can query equipment health in plain language—without data ever crossing the plant network boundary. Because the model runs inside your OT environment, it works across air-gapped cells and SCADA-adjacent systems where cloud connectivity is prohibited.
This same infrastructure powers agentic workflows that can automatically escalate anomalies to maintenance queues, draft repair summaries, and surface relevant sections of P&IDs or calibration procedures—turning reactive maintenance cycles into a continuous, documented intelligence loop.
Quality Analysis, Defect Review, and Work Instructions
Quality managers and process engineers deal with an enormous volume of unstructured text: inspection reports, nonconformance records, customer complaints, PPAP documentation, and FMEA logs. A domain-tuned LLM can synthesize those sources to surface defect patterns, flag recurring root causes, and generate pre-audit summaries aligned to ISO 9001, IATF 16949, or AS9100 requirements. The model grounds every response in your own controlled documents via retrieval-augmented generation, so outputs are traceable and explainable—not hallucinated.
Dynamic work instructions are another high-value output. Rather than maintaining hundreds of static PDFs across product variants and revision levels, engineers can query the model for step-by-step assembly or calibration procedures tailored to a specific part number, machine configuration, or shift condition. The result is faster onboarding, fewer rework events, and a living knowledge base that updates as your documentation changes.
Supply Chain and Procurement AI Inside Your Perimeter
Supply chain operations generate dense, high-stakes text—supplier contracts, material certifications, RFQs, delivery exceptions, and regulatory declarations of conformance. An on-prem AI trained on your supplier database and procurement history can summarize contract obligations, flag non-standard terms, and draft standardized follow-up communications in seconds. Because the model never reaches a public API, sensitive sourcing strategies, cost structures, and preferred-vendor arrangements remain fully confidential.
For manufacturers navigating ITAR, EAR, or dual-use export controls, keeping AI inference inside a controlled network is not optional—it is a compliance requirement. 01Can a private LLM run in an air-gapped OT environment with no internet access?
Yes. LLM.co deployments are designed to operate fully offline inside isolated operational technology networks. All model weights, document embeddings, and inference compute are contained within your facility. There is no dependency on an external API or cloud endpoint, making the setup compatible with air-gapped cells, SCADA-adjacent systems, and environments governed by ITAR, CMMC, or ICS security frameworks.
02How does a manufacturing LLM handle predictive maintenance without sending sensor data to the cloud?
The model is deployed at the edge or on on-premises servers and ingests maintenance logs, sensor telemetry, and equipment history directly from local data historians or MES integrations. Technicians query the system in natural language and receive grounded answers drawn from your actual maintenance records. No raw sensor data or proprietary process parameters are transmitted outside the plant network.
03What document types can the LLM ingest for manufacturing use cases?
The platform ingests PDFs, Word documents, CAD-linked technical documents, work instructions, SOPs, P&IDs, engineering change orders, FMEA logs, inspection reports, supplier certifications, and structured data exports from ERP, MES, or PLM systems.
